The Fitbit Charge 6 may be smaller than other smartwatches on the market, but it’s packed with excellent features and a slew of new Google apps for keeping up with your health and wellness. Compatible with numerous exercise machines and loaded with 40 different exercise modes, the Charge 6 also has enough battery life to last an entire week.

We tested the Charge 6 over a year ago, and reviewer Joe Maring had this to say: “The Fitbit Charge 6 offers excellent health tracking and helpful Google apps in a sleek design — and at an incredible price.” Other noteworthy features include a 1.4-inch AMOLED display that delivers up to 450 nits at peak brightness, a lightweight fit, and three color options, including Black (with a Black band), Gold (with a Red Band), and Silver (with a White Band).

The Fitbit Versa 4 has been a fan favorite across the board, and we’re here to join the fanfare! This impressive Android-powered smartwatch is a cosmetic delight and feels good to wear for hours on end. An improved touchscreen (compared to the Versa 3) is far better at handling taps and swipes, and the latest generation even lets you use Alexa voice commands to control the wearable.

While we wish there were third-party apps to enjoy, the Versa 4 is a terrific midrange smartwatch with excellent battery life and an intuitive interface.

The Apple Watch Series 10 was announced at Apple's It's Glowtime event, and while it hasn't been released yet, there's already a lot of interest in the wearable device. It's powered by Apple's S10 chipset that maximizes its efficiency, with a battery that can replenish 80% after just 30 minutes of charging. Health and fitness tracking is still amazing in the Apple Watch Series 10, which adds features such as sleep apnea detection, depth gauge and water temperature sensors, and the Vitals app that can measure your Training Load to inform you whether you're pushing too hard or you can work out a bit more.
